WebThe smallest cycloalkane is cyclopropane. Figure 4.1.1: If you count the carbons and hydrogens, you will see that they no longer fit the general formula C n H 2 n + 2. By joining the carbon atoms in a ring,two hydrogen atoms have been lost. The general formula for a cycloalkane is C n H 2 n. Cyclic compounds are not all flat molecules. WebBased on the putative structures and molecular weights of the cyclopropyl-GSH conjugates, a multi-step mechanism was proposed to explain the formation of these metabolites by P450. This mechanism involves hydrogen atom abstraction to form a cyclopropyl radical, followed by a ring opening rearrangement and reaction with GSH. 3. WebCyclopropane is the cycloalkane with the molecular formula (CH 2) 3, consisting of three methylene groups (CH 2) linked to each other to form a ring. The small size of the ring creates substantial ring strain in the structure.

WebCyclopropanol is an organic compound with the chemical formula C 3 H 6 O. It contains a cyclopropyl group with a hydroxyl group attached to it.
